The selection spans cities like Des Moines, Coralville, and Davenport, with events running from February through late April. The Iowa Limestone Producers Association Annual Convention in February is an early anchor for anyone working in materials or extraction. Later in spring, the Performance FoodService TPC Food Show in Davenport draws buyers and suppliers looking to move product and build distributor relationships. For operators tracking regional pipelines, these events offer direct access to decision-makers without the travel overhead of larger national shows. If your business touches Iowa in any meaningful way, knowing when and where these gatherings happen gives you a practical edge in timing outreach and showing up where your contacts already are.

Takeaways
Among the 9 industry conferences in Iowa, 0 sit at Tier A.
Des Moines hosts the most events in this cut, with 3 on the calendar.
April is the busiest month, with 4 conferences scheduled.
Ticket pricing splits 4 at the $ tier and 0 at the $$$ tier, so entry costs vary widely across the set.
Iowa Dental Association IDEAS Annual Session tops the Tier-ranked list, held in Des Moines.
The most common stated purpose is Training / Certification, covering 7 of the 9 events in this cut.
Event length averages 2.5 days across the set, with the longest running 4 days.
